Allows you to view and/or retrieve older snapshots of the files and directories in a project.ī. Which of these is untrue about the Git and GitHub version control software?Ī. If you cannot easily answer these questions we recommend you go back toįrom Data Science: A First Introduction and read (or re-read) it.ġ. Here’s a poll to check you have the prerequisite knowledge for this chapter. We expect some introductory version control knowledge before the contents of this chapter.Ĭhapter 12: Collaboration with version control Source: Data Science: A First Introduction A poll! # A schematic of local and remote version control repositories using these tools is shown below: In this course we will learn to use the most popular version control software tools, Git and GitHub. It also provides the means both to view earlier versions of the project and to revert changes.” “Version control is the process of keeping a record of changes to documents, including when the changes were made and who made them, throughout the history of their development. Understanding public key private key concepts.Remotely accessing another computer using SSH.Exercise: Getting to know GitHub milestones.Exercise: Getting to know GitHub project boards.Why use project boards for collaborative software projects?.What happens when my feature branch falls behind main?.Useful things you can do with branches on GitHub.Demo: Accept suggested changes from a code review:.Code reviews using in-line comments and suggested code fixes.Useful command line Git branching commands.Getting remote branches you did not create locally.Switching to branches that already exist.Creating a branch using the command line.Creating a branch using the JupyterLab Git extension.Bringing something something from the back from the past.Travelling in time or bringing something something from the back from the past:.Resolving merge conflicts in a more complex text file:. Resolving merge conflicts in a simple text file:.Hands on practice with merge conflicts!.Common Git commands at the command line.
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|